WebThe Harbour Master has a duty to inform vessels about any hazards or problems that may affect safe navigation, for example: Any obstructions in channels or alongside berths Limitations of tugs Weather restrictions in the harbour or at berths Any failure of any aids to navigation such as lights or buoys Vessel Types Web149.
